Breaking News: Migrant Shipwreck Off Lampedusa – 21 Missing, 7 Rescued | Analysis & Impact In a tragic incident off the coast of Lampedusa, a migrant shipwreck has left 21 people missing at sea. The Italian coast guard has rescued 7 survivors, all male Syrian nationals, who were found on a semi-sunken boat. According to reports, the survivors had set off from Libya and revealed that 21 of the 28 people on board, including three children, had fallen into the sea during rough weather. Occidental Petroleum Corporation (NYSE: OXY) shares have reached a 52-week low, dropping to $55.04, amidst the complexities of the energy market. This decline marks a significant departure from the company’s performance over the past year, with Occidental stock experiencing a -16.71% change. The downward trend reflects broader industry patterns and investor sentiment, as the company adapts to fluctuating oil prices, regulatory shifts, and changing global demand. Stakeholders are closely monitoring Occidental’s strategic initiatives to strengthen its financial position and market standing, in the face of heightened volatility and economic uncertainty. Dolce & Gabbana’s Strategic Moves: What Investors Need to Know About the Latest Fiscal Year Loss and Revenue Growth MILAN (Multibagger) – Dolce & Gabbana Holding reported a significant increase in its operating loss to €13 million ($14.4 million) for the fiscal year ending in March. This widened loss is primarily due to substantial investments in expanding its store network and internalizing its beauty division, according to a recent filing. The Best Investment Manager’s Guide: U.S. Federal Reserve Likely to Cut Rates by 50 bps in September – CME Group Data Reveals According to the latest data from the CME Group, there has been a significant increase in the likelihood of a larger 50 basis point (bps) rate cut from the U.S. Federal Reserve in September. The probability of a rate cut from the current 5.25 – 5.50% rate to 4.75 – 5.00% now stands at 48%, up from 42% the previous day and 36% last week. Lyft (NASDAQ: LYFT) Restructuring Plan Receives Hold Rating from TD Cowen: What Investors Need to Know TD Cowen has reaffirmed its "Hold" rating on Lyft (NASDAQ: LYFT), with a $15.00 price target, following the ride-hailing company’s announcement of a restructuring plan for its bikes and scooters division. The plan aims to optimize consumer offerings and enhance the company’s cost structure through asset disposal and a 1% reduction in the total workforce. Lyft expects to incur most of the restructuring charges in the third quarter of 2024, focusing on streamlining operations and achieving profitability. Federal Judge Allows Class Action Age Discrimination Lawsuit Against Elon Musk’s X: Potential Multi-Million Dollar Impact By Daniel Wiessner San Francisco, Multibagger — In a landmark ruling, a federal judge has granted approximately 150 older employees, who were laid off by social media giant X (formerly Twitter) following Elon Musk’s acquisition, the green light to pursue a class action lawsuit on grounds of age discrimination. This decision could potentially expose X to millions of dollars in liabilities.
